Join DLC and the Town of Davidson for a screening of: My Garden of a Thousand Bees. Locked down during the coronavirus pandemic, My Garden of a Thousand Bees follows acclaimed wildlife filmmaker Martin Dohrn as he sets out to record all the bee species in his tiny urban garden in Bristol, England. Over long months, Dohrn observes differences in behavior that set species apart. He eventually gets so close to the bees he can identify individuals by sight, documenting life at their level as we have never seen.

There will be a Q&A after the screening with Davidson Garden Club member and Master Gardener, Sylvia Hindman.  We will be discussing gardening techniques that attract and support pollinators.
